Kimon designing for the future

Look who’s having a successful year? It’s 27-year-old fashion designer Kimon Baptiste. Searchlight sat down to chat with the creative Pieces-born former Girls’ High School student to find out a little more about her.

We learnt that the lass, who hails from Richmond Hill, is currently attending the University of the West Indies pursuing a Bachelor of Science Degree in management with a minor in psychology.

Q: Why are you doing management at UWI?

A: Well, I believe in being multifaceted. I guess with the management part, I could manage my finances because I plan to continue fashion, but that has always been part time. I love both Fashion and Human Resources. {{more}}

Q: How did the interest in fashion start for you?

A: Well, growing up I was an only girl. I had two older brothers so all I had to keep my company were dolls. I used to make clothes for my dolls because I had aunts who were seamstresses. I used to get pieces of fabrics to sew, so I’ve been doing this for a long time. I only started doing fashion shows, I think, after I won Miss SVG in 1999. That’s when I started putting my work in the public eye, thanks to Monique from Image Modelling Agency.

Q: So you designed your own evening gown?

A: Yeah, back then I did, and I also won in that category in the show. But my aunt from Trinidad sewed it for me, cause around that time I don’t think I had the confidence yet to do my own thing.

Q: So now, do you sew?

A: Yes!!! Actually I’ve realised that my passion is evening gowns. We now have a pageant for campus carnival and I did a gown for Tanya Fraser and she won. It was the rave on campus.

Ever since then, I’ve been getting a lot of people wanting evening gowns and dinner dresses. That’s what I enjoy doing.

Q: I’ve seen your gowns and they are right up there with the top designers. How do you price them?

A: Thanks… The price, well it depends on the style and the calibre of the show. It all depends and it varies. It depends on the service that I provide. There are people who don’t have a clue of what they want and obviously that would cost more. But there are people who present an idea and I would bring that idea to life, in terms of finding the fabric, decorations and sewing it. So it all varies.

Q: What sort of designs do you do besides gowns?

A: Everything… Just recently I designed a swimsuit for Canouan Carnival and the young lady won Best Swimsuit. That was my first attempt at designing a swimsuit. So I do everything, it’s not just gowns. Gowns are my passion, but I do everything from casuals to formal wear. I want to dip my hands into everything.

Q: Where do you see yourself in the future?

A: I plan to continue fashion. It’s a talent and I’ve heard that if you don’t use it, you would lose it.(smiles) So it’s something I plan to continue doing well into my old age, but I plan to also be successful in the managerial filed.

Q: What are the colours you like to use when designing?

A: I love colours, anything from yellow, to pink, to baby blue to green. I just love bright radiant colours.

Q: Is there anybody you would like to meet in the fashion world?

A: At this point, anybody. Anybody that could give me positive advice and who would be an influence. I would be delighted to meet anybody in the fashion industry, because I think that they are all good. So getting the chance to meet any of them would be good enough for me.

Q: Don’t you think that it’s only a matter of time before you become a big name designer?

A: Yes. I hope so.

Q: So what’s your focus right now?

A: I’d have to say on school. This is the final year so it’s crunch time. I can’t afford to fail any courses because they are expensive. So school is the target, but that would not keep me from sewing just a little bit. It’s just a matter of scheduling myself properly.
